You can open a case with Amazon DLS and request FMLA leave even before you get an actual doctors note. I believe you have like 30 days to provide the actual documentation once your case is approved. Personally I would check with my doctor first to see if they agree on the leave.

It's not necessary to go through a therapist or psychiatrist to qualify for leave. Ask if your Primary Care Provider (PCP) can write a note for anxiety and categorize it under ICD F41.9 - "Anxiety disorder, unspecified". Your doctor will need to fill out a few forms that Amazon DLS will provide once you formally request FMLA leave and if you want to use Short Term Disability benefits (to get up to 60% base salary while on leave).

If you do want the therapist/psychiatrist route, you can also call your medical insurance and ask them to provide a list of mental health providers in your area that are in-network. Unfortunately finding a therapist that you like is akin to the dating game. It might take you a few tries to find someone that clicks.

To avoid the piercing of primers, use a small rifle magnum primer (CCI450, #41, etc.) that has a thicker cup. Regular small rifle primers have a thinner cup, hence the occasional piercing.

There's a chart here that maps out some of the cup thickness of some primers.

https://bulletin.accurateshooter.com/2020/02/primers-and-pressure-tolerances-how-primers-vary/

If the primers still pierce with a magnum primer, it could be a case where the large firing pin (and the firing pin hole in your bolt) have excessive gap where primer metal can flow. I believe a long time ago there were services to tighten the gap between the firing pin hole and pin itself. These days some manufacturers just switched to small firing pins avoid the primer piercing issues commonly found with 6.5 Creedmoor.

Edit: When switching to magnum primers, some brands have a bit more oomph. Unfortunately.. you may need to rework your recipe.

As a starting scope I would recommend looking at the SWFA lineup. Their scopes are mostly sourced from Japanese OEMs and are have good feel/mechanics. I have a SS 12x that has been on a few rifles and has been working great for the past few years. The glass in the classic SS line isn't the best, but the tracking is on point.

When looking at the competition, Primary Arms and Athlon scopes all seem to use modified version of a Chinese OEM scope. There many other value oriented brands (Centerpoint, Weaver Kaspa, Falcon Menace, etc etc.) out there that all seem to use a similar body / tube construction. Just take a look on Alibaba.com and type in a scope zoom range (ie. 6-24x50) and take a look at the results. The turrets are most likely to be more mushy in feel and overall less refined compared to pricier alternatives. I had one of these scopes before and it worked just fine, however the glass was just OK and the turrets did leave a lot to be desired. The exception would be the Athlon Cronus line that is priced at a premium and sourced from Japan. Build quality on those should be similar the scopes in that price category. There is a guy on SH that did a tracking test on an Athlon Cronus scope and it did fine.

I used some latex caulk with silicone recently to fill a stock.

Readily available at any hardware store. Adds probably a pound or so to the rear end and removes the hollow noise. It is kind of messy though and the stuff needs air to dry out.

Initially I tried some steel BBs, but those make noise with any movement in the stock.
